Thank you @Hub6Active, those LZs look really nice!

However, and I personally feel quite strong about this, therefore:
ORIGINAL: Hub6Actual

Download the included Map folder into your CSVN main directory to use. All the original game files are included in the download, in case you wish to go back to them.

What Hub6Actual is saying is that please place the downloaded folder to your \Mods folder, to be activated by JSGME. JSGME is included in this game for a reason, and I promise once you've used it once you don't ever want to go back to tinkering with individual files in game folders. [:)]

This download is almost but not quite JSGME ready, so after having unzipped the file, create a new folder under the "Alt LZ Air Arty Markers CSVN" folder, name it "Graphics", put the Map folder and its content there.

Then, fire up JSGME, activate the mod, and there you go. To go back to stock look of the game, just deactivate it and you're back without any file tinkering.

Again, sorry for going on about this, but I feel very strongly about this, as the game is quite suspect to faulty files in the system.
